[CFV] GBT05: The Dragon Fang That Glitters in the Moonlight


~British Soul~

Recommended Posts

q4jr6zs.jpg

 

- November 13th

Includes 104 cards (2 GR, 8 RRR, 12 RR, 22 R and 60 C) + 12 SP (Parallel) cards. There are 102 new cards and 2 reprints.

- The reprints are Battle Sister, Taffy and Lady Battler of the White Dwarf

 

Clans:

- Gear Chronicle

- Pale Moon

- Link Joker

- Oracle Think Tank

- Narukami

+ Cray Elemental

 

2 new keywords (Oracle and Thunder Strike)

Oracle is active when you have 5+ cards in your hand (OTT)

Thunder Strike is dependant on your opponent's Bind Zone (Narukami)

 

2ze5SGj.jpg

Rigid Crane

Oracle Think Tank

[CONT](RC) Generation Break 1 Oracle (This ability is active if you have five or more cards in your hand.): During your turn, this unit gets [Power]+2000 and "[AUTO](RC):When this unit's attack hits, Counter Charge (1)/Soul Charge (1).".

 

Cloudmaster Dragon

Narukami

[AUTO] Generation Break 1 Thunder Strike 2 (This ability is active if your opponent has two or more cards in their bind zone):When this unit is placed on (RC), until end of turn, this unit get [Power]+2000 for each card in your opponent's bind zone, and all of your opponent's units cannot intercept.

 

Also, Magus, Eradictor, Star-Vader and Nightmare Doll support in this set as well.
